I've been on Hydroxyurea 500mg for a few months now for my sickle cell anemia, and I have to say, it's been a game-changer. My painful crises have significantly decreased, and I feel like I have more energy throughout the day. However, I've also experienced some side effects that I wasn't expecting. I wanted to share my experience and hear from others who have been on this medication. How has it worked for you? What side effects have you encountered, and how have you managed them? Do you have regular blood tests? What has been your experience with the doctors ordering the medication?

I'm on this medication for sickle cell anemia as well. The side effects are definitely manageable compared to the number of pain crises i've had without it. However, one thing I noticed that no one told me was about the skin ulcers. I developed some on my legs and had to go to the ER. Just be vigilant about any skin changes!
